Said to be accurate, fast, and rugged enough for field applications, the MA24106A, USB-powered sensor measures true-RMS power, regardless of the input signal or bandwidth, over a dynamic range of 63 dB from 50 MHz to 6 GHz. Suitable for measuring average power of CW, multi-tone, and modulated RF waveforms, the MA24106A provides a more cost-effective alternative to benchtop power meters as it communicates to a PC via its USB interface. Additionally, there is no need for a reference calibrator typically required by power meters, minimizing test station complexity and sensor handling while reducing test times. The standards used to calibrate the instrument are directly traceable to NIST. Other features include a typical accuracy of ±0.13 dB, power-handling capability of +33 dBm, 3.3 kV of ESD protection, and a current consumption of 100 mA. Starting price for the MA24106A is $2,400.
